From fa499f99b3acf00cabe33503b2dd38de45068169 Mon Sep 17 00:00:00 2001 From: Sergio Elvira Perez Date: Wed, 23 Feb 2022 16:25:55 +0100 Subject: [PATCH] OEL-1175: Image and styles added to solve required fields on forms. --- assets/images/required.svg | 1 + resources/sass/components/_all.scss | 1 + resources/sass/components/_form.scss | 19 +++++++++++++++++++ 3 files changed, 21 insertions(+) create mode 100644 assets/images/required.svg create mode 100644 resources/sass/components/_form.scss diff --git a/assets/images/required.svg b/assets/images/required.svg new file mode 100644 index 000000000..f7882d6df --- /dev/null +++ b/assets/images/required.svg @@ -0,0 +1 @@ + diff --git a/resources/sass/components/_all.scss b/resources/sass/components/_all.scss index b5bf8d950..0252da2af 100644 --- a/resources/sass/components/_all.scss +++ b/resources/sass/components/_all.scss @@ -2,3 +2,4 @@ // ----------------------------------------------------------------------------- @import 'blockquote'; @import 'navbar'; +@import 'form'; diff --git a/resources/sass/components/_form.scss b/resources/sass/components/_form.scss new file mode 100644 index 000000000..aed601f8a --- /dev/null +++ b/resources/sass/components/_form.scss @@ -0,0 +1,19 @@ +// form +// https://getbootstrap.com/docs/5.0/forms/overview/ +// ----------------------------------------------------------------------------- + +// Custom css for forms. +/** + * Required field + */ +.form-required:after { + content: ''; + vertical-align: super; + display: inline-block; + background-image: url(../images/required.svg); + background-repeat: no-repeat; + background-size: 6px 6px; + width: 6px; + height: 6px; + margin: 0 0.3em; +}